The Flakiest Pie Crust

  1. Heat oven to 425 degrees.
  2. In a bowl, combine flour and salt.
  3. Blend in spread with a pastry blender (2 forks work just as well).
  4. Sprinkle in ice water 1 tablespoon at a time.
  5. Shape into disc and cover with plastic wrap and chill for 20 minutes.
  6. On floured surface, roll out dough into a 12 inch circle; transfer to pie plate.
  7. Chill 20 minutes.
  8. Pierce crust with fork and line with foil.
  9. Fill pie with pie weights (dried beans and/or rice also work well).
  10. Bake 10 minutes and remove pie weights and foil.
  11. Bake an additional 10 minutes more, or until golden.
  12. Cool completely.

flour, salt, cold butter, water
